Against a backdrop of deep national division, Massachusetts governor Dominic Nelson's presidential hopes fade amid a polarized primary race. Choosing to break from the two-party system, Nelson launches an Independent campaign with an unorthodox campaign manager: Fred Hoffman, childhood friend and a controversial political scientist. As their revolutionary platform and unconventional plan to save America ignite fierce debate across the country, a shocking turn of events thrusts Hoffman to the forefront of the campaign, pushing both men into a high-stakes political storm that could either save the nation or tear it apart.
